In a bold assertion that underscores his administration’s aggressive stance on Iran, President Donald Trump declared that any country engaging in oil purchases from Iran will face restrictions on doing business with the United States. This announcement, made during a recent press briefing, emphasizes the Trump administration’s commitment to reimposing stringent sanctions against Tehran, aimed at curbing its nuclear ambitions and destabilizing activities in the Middle East. The warning raises critical questions about the potential impact on global oil markets, international relations, and the economic ties between the U.S. and its allies. As countries navigate the complexities of compliance with U.S. policy, the implications for energy trade and geopolitical dynamics remain significant.
